#9f542e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9f542e is composed of 62.4% red, 32.9%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.2% magenta, 71.1%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 20.2 degrees, a saturation of 55.1% and a lightness of 40.2%. #9f542e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a85c with #3f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#9f542e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9f542e has RGB values of R:159, G:84,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.71,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10441774.
